I'm two years in to an Optima D51 YellowTop battery on my NH TC33D tractor, and it's still going strong. I do put it on a BatteryMinder maintainer/desulphater when the Tractor is not used for extended periods. (I switched to this when 3 OEM batteries ended up only giving me 3 years of life each, despite regular use of the battery maintainer. In addition to failing after 3 years, each also had serious corrosion issues. The charging voltage checked out. I think it was the vibration that got to them.)
I'm glad I got it when I did. I purchased it for $160 on Amazon in April 2016. The same battery now lists for $240. Does anyone know what is driving this huge jump in price? Are other brands of AGM batteries seeing the same jump?
